영문 초록
To investigate and compare the effects on the respiratory system of a power walking exercise program with a muscle strengthening exercise program. Subjects were randomly divided into two groups of ten. One group carried out the abdominal strengthening exercises along with upper extremity strengthening exercises, and the other group completed the power walking exercises. Each group performed their exercises three times a week during the entire 4 weeks of the experiment. The upper extremity exercises were 3 sets of 15 push-ups with 30 seconds of rest per a set. The abdominal muscle strengthening exercises consisted of 3 sets of the plank, the side plank, the crunch, and the cross crunch. For each set the exercise was held for 15 seconds followed by a 30 second rest. The power walking was performed for 50 minutes each time. There was no significant improvement of the FVC or the FEV1 in the power walking group. The FVC before the experiment was 3.82±0.62, and 3.85±0.61 after the experiment. While the FEV1 went from 3.41±0.63 before the experiment to 3.48±0.65 afterwards. Meanwhile there was significant improvement in the abdominal muscle strengthening group. The FVC started at 3.24±0.74 before the experiment finished at 3.40±0.81 after the experiment. As for the FEV1, it went from 2.95±0.76 beforehand to 3.12±0.73 afterwards. This study shows that an effective way to improve respiratory function is with an exercise program that combines abdominal muscle strengthening exercises with upper extremity exercises. This knowledge can be used to help design a muscle strengthening program that improves respiratory function. Additionally abdominal muscle strengthening exercises with upper extremity exercises can be used as a component of a self exercise program or a clinical intervention program.
